BLYTH HOLDINGS HAS NEW PRESIDENT

By CBR Staff Writer

Tim Negris, who just went over to tools house Blyth Holdings Inc as executive vice president, marketing and development from IBM Corp, is now president and chief executive. Mike Minor has stepped down as chief execuive and chairman, the president and chief operating officer has also gone and Richard Hanschen is back as chairman. Blyth is about to launch an advanced components-style object-oriented edition of the Omnis scripting environment for Java Beans and ActiveX programming.
